I have it in my 02 Trans Am Firehawk. I didn't buy anything to eliminate it, but you just learn to keep it in the lower gear longer until the skip feature is no longer activated. I am so used to doing this that I never think about it, although it seems to me that by doing this, maybe I am using more gas keeping it in first longer. Doesn't that defeat the purpose of the feature (to save gas)?
Skipshift serves 2 purposes:

1) It helps raise the rated fuel economy
2) It encourages drivers to be a little more aggressive.
